Key Contributions
Trivers is best known for developing several influential concepts in evolutionary theory:
- Reciprocal Altruism: Introduced in the early 1970s, this theory explains how cooperation can evolve among unrelated individuals. Trivers argued that individuals often help one another with the expectation that the favor will be returned in the future, hence developing long-term social bonds.
- Parental Investment Theory: This concept explores how the allocation of parental resources affects breeding strategies. According to Trivers, the sex that invests more in offspring (usually females) will be more selective in mating, while the less-investing sex (males) will compete for access to the higher-investing sex.
- Sexual Selection and the Evolution of Selfish Behavior: Trivers also explored how sexual selection influences social dynamics and conflict within species, particularly in terms of aggressive behavior and mating strategies.
